COMMENTS:

This lens has gotten surprisingly good reviews for an inexpensive macro lens. Mechanical construction leaves something to be desired, autofocus is a little rough and it only goes to 1/2 life size (1:2) without the (supplied) closeup lens. It goes to 1:1 with the (supplied) diopter. Optically it's actually pretty good and it's certainly the cheapest 100mm macro lens around. It's cheaper than any of the 50mm macros too. Optically, it's a bargain.

The same lens is sold under a variety of brand names. Vivitar, Phoenix, ProMaster etc. and I believe thay are all actually made by Cosina and "branded" for resale by various other companies.
